Tip 1: Prioritize Weight Distribution: When packing, heavier items should be positioned closer to the wearer’s back. This mitigates strain and promotes better posture, especially during extended periods of wear. For example, a laptop should be placed in the dedicated compartment closest to the back panel.

Tip 2: Utilize Dedicated Compartments: This product line typically includes various organizational pockets and compartments. Utilize these to separate items, preventing damage and facilitating easy access. Example: Keep electronic devices in padded compartments and avoid placing sharp objects alongside delicate items.

Tip 3: Employ Proper Cleaning Techniques: Regularly clean the exterior surfaces with a soft, damp cloth. Avoid harsh chemicals or abrasive cleaners, as these can damage the material and alter the appearance. For example, spot clean stains promptly rather than allowing them to set.

Tip 4: Secure Zippers and Closures: Ensure all zippers and closures are fully secured to prevent accidental spills or loss of items. Regularly inspect zippers for wear and tear and address any issues promptly. A malfunctioning zipper can compromise the security of the contents.

Tip 5: Protect Against the Elements: While often constructed from durable materials, prolonged exposure to harsh weather conditions can degrade the fabric over time. Consider using a rain cover or protective spray during inclement weather. This preserves the appearance and integrity of the material.

Tip 6: Limit Overloading: Exceeding the recommended weight capacity can strain the seams, zippers, and straps, leading to premature wear and potential failure. Adhere to the manufacturer’s guidelines regarding maximum weight limits. Overstuffing also increases the risk of damage to contents.

Tip 7: Store Appropriately When Not in Use: When not in use, store the item in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ight. This prevents fading and potential damage to the fabric and components. Stuffing the bag with paper or cloth can help maintain its shape.

Durability is a central attribute of items within the Tumi Alpha Bravo backpack line, significantly influencing their value and suitability for demanding use. The materials and construction techniques employed are specifically chosen to withstand wear and tear, ensuring a prolonged lifespan for the product. This emphasis on durability translates to a reliable carrying solution for professionals and travelers.

  • Ballistic Nylon Construction

    The primary material used in many Tumi Alpha Bravo backpacks is ballistic nylon, originally developed for flak jackets during World War II. This tightly woven nylon fabric exhibits exceptional abrasion resistance, tear strength, and water repellency. For example, the material can withstand the rigors of daily commuting, resisting scuffs and scrapes that would damage lesser materials. This contributes significantly to the overall longevity of the backpack.

  • Reinforced Stitching and Seams

    Beyond the inherent strength of the materials, reinforced stitching and seams play a critical role in durability. Stress points, such as the shoulder strap attachment points and zipper areas, are often double-stitched or bar-tacked to prevent separation under load. For instance, the bottom corners of the backpack, which are subject to abrasion, often feature reinforced stitching to prevent wear. This careful attention to detail ensures that the backpack can withstand significant weight and stress without failing.

  • High-Quality Hardware

    The hardware components, including zippers, buckles, and clasps, are also selected for their durability and reliability. High-quality zippers, often sourced from reputable manufacturers, are less prone to breakage or snagging. Buckles and clasps are made from durable materials that can withstand repeated use and exposure to the elements. For example, metal zippers are often used instead of plastic ones for their increased strength and resistance to wear. This ensures that these critical components will function reliably throughout the life of the backpack.

  • Water Resistance and Protection

    While not always fully waterproof, many Tumi Alpha Bravo backpacks feature water-resistant coatings or treatments to protect the contents from light rain or spills. This helps to prevent damage to electronic devices or documents. For example, a water-resistant lining inside the backpack can prevent moisture from seeping through the seams. This added protection enhances the durability of the backpack by preventing water damage, which can degrade the materials and shorten its lifespan.

  • Ballistic Nylon

    Ballistic nylon, a densely woven synthetic fabric, serves as a primary component in many Tumi Alpha Bravo backpacks. Its origins trace back to World War II, where it was developed for flak jackets. In the context of backpacks, ballistic nylon exhibits exceptional abrasion resistance, preventing scuffs and tears that would compromise structural integrity. For instance, repeated contact with rough surfaces during travel poses minimal risk of damage. This robustness translates to a prolonged product lifespan, justifying the investment for discerning consumers.

  • High-Quality Zippers

    Zippers, often overlooked, are integral to the functionality and longevity of a backpack. The Tumi Alpha Bravo series typically incorporates zippers from reputable manufacturers known for their precision engineering and durability. These zippers are designed to withstand frequent use without jamming, breaking, or separating. For example, a robust zipper ensures secure closure of compartments, protecting contents from loss or damage. The choice of metal over plastic zippers further enhances durability, albeit at a higher cost.

  • Reinforced Stitching

    The strength of a backpack relies not only on the materials used but also on the integrity of the stitching. Tumi Alpha Bravo backpacks employ reinforced stitching techniques, particularly at stress points such as shoulder strap attachments and zipper junctions. This reinforcement prevents seams from unraveling under load, ensuring structural stability. For example, double-stitched seams at the base of the backpack withstand significant weight without compromising the integrity of the construction. This attention to detail contributes to the overall durability and reliability of the product.

  • Protective Linings

    Interior linings serve a crucial role in protecting the contents of the backpack from scratches, moisture, and other potential hazards. The Tumi Alpha Bravo series often utilizes specialized linings that are both durable and easy to clean. These linings prevent delicate items, such as electronic devices, from being damaged by friction or impact. For example, a padded laptop compartment with a soft lining safeguards the device during transport. The choice of moisture-resistant materials further protects contents from spills or light rain.

Question 1: What distinguishes Tumi Alpha Bravo backpacks from other Tumi backpack collections?

The Alpha Bravo collection emphasizes rugged durability and functional organization tailored for business and travel. While other Tumi lines may prioritize different aesthetic styles or specialized features, the Alpha Bravo line focuses on robust construction and practical compartment design for demanding use.

Question 2: Are Tumi Alpha Bravo backpacks waterproof?

While often featuring water-resistant materials and construction, these backpacks are generally not fully waterproof. They offer protection against light rain and spills, but prolonged exposure to heavy precipitation may require additional protection such as a rain cover to safeguard electronic devices and other sensitive items.

Question 3: What is the typical lifespan of a Tumi Alpha Bravo backpack?

The lifespan is influenced by usage frequency and care. Under normal conditions and with proper maintenance, a Tumi Alpha Bravo backpack can reasonably be expected to provide several years of reliable service. The durable materials and construction contribute to its longevity.

Question 4: Can Tumi Alpha Bravo backpacks be repaired if damaged?

Tumi offers repair services for its products, subject to assessment and available parts. Damage caused by normal wear and tear or manufacturing defects may be eligible for repair under warranty or as a paid service. Contact Tumi customer service for specific repair inquiries.

Question 5: What is the weight capacity of a Tumi Alpha Bravo backpack?

The weight capacity varies by model, but generally ranges from 20 to 30 pounds. Exceeding the recommended weight limit can strain seams and zippers, potentially shortening the product’s lifespan. Refer to the specific product specifications for accurate weight capacity information.

Question 6: How should a Tumi Alpha Bravo backpack be cleaned?

Clean exterior surfaces with a soft, damp cloth. Avoid harsh chemicals or abrasive cleaners, as these can damage the fabric. Spot clean stains promptly. For more extensive cleaning needs, consult a professional cleaner specializing in luggage and bag care.
